-
>
全國計算機等級考試最新真考題庫模擬考場及詳解·二級MSOffice高級應用
-
>
決戰行測5000題(言語理解與表達)
-
>
軟件性能測試.分析與調優實踐之路
-
>
第一行代碼Android
-
>
JAVA持續交付
-
>
EXCEL最強教科書(完全版)(全彩印刷)
-
>
深度學習
數據庫應用、設計與實現 第2版 版權信息
- ISBN:9787302560067
- 條形碼:9787302560067 ; 978-7-302-56006-7
- 裝幀:一般膠版紙
- 冊數:暫無
- 重量:暫無
- 所屬分類:>
數據庫應用、設計與實現 第2版 內容簡介
本教材按順序可以分為五大部分。**部分是基本概念和基礎知識。第二部分主要分三、四、五三章講SQL語言及其應用。第三部分是第六章和第七章講數據庫設計。第四部分是大數據新技術。第五部分給出一個完整的實際案例。
數據庫應用、設計與實現 第2版 目錄
目錄
第 一 部 分
第1章緒論/3
1.1什么是數據庫系統3
1.1.1數據庫與大數據3
1.1.2數據庫管理系統4
1.1.3數據庫系統5
1.2為什么需要數據庫系統5
1.2.1DBS前的困境6
1.2.2DBS的吸引力6
1.3數據抽象8
1.3.1四層抽象8
1.3.2數據抽象的表達8
1.3.3三層模式和兩級映射10
1.4DBMS11
1.4.1數據定義語言13
1.4.2數據操作語言13
1.4.3數據保護語言13
1.4.4查詢處理13
1.4.5存儲管理14
1.4.6保護管理14
1.4.7物理數據結構14
1.4.8立足點15
1.5DBS15
1.5.1硬件15
1.5.2軟件16
1.5.3用戶17
1.5.4工作過程17
1.5.5在網絡上18
1.6大數據與數據管理技術發展趨勢20
習題20數據庫應用、設計與實現(第2版)目錄第2章關系模型/22
2.1關系結構與約束22
2.1.1關系與表22
2.1.2關系鍵25
2.1.3約束25
2.2關系操作26
2.2.1基本關系代數運算26
2.2.2附加關系代數運算33
2.2.3擴展關系代數運算36
2.2.4數據庫修改39
習題40
第 二 部 分
第3章MySQL數據定義與操作/45
3.1SQL與MySQL45
3.1.1SQL發展史45
3.1.2MySQL46
3.1.3數據庫語言組成46
3.1.4數據庫語言的特點46
3.1.5考試系統數據庫47
3.2數據定義49
3.2.1MySQL的基本數據類型49
3.2.2表的創建、修改和刪除50
3.3投影與廣義投影52
3.4選擇54
3.5集合操作58
3.6聯接查詢59
3.6.1笛卡兒積59
3.6.2內聯接60
3.6.3外聯接61
3.7更名64
3.8聚集查詢64
3.8.1基本聚集64
3.8.2分組65
3.8.3排名67
3.8.4分窗69
3.9基本查詢語句的一般形式69
3.10嵌套查詢70
3.10.1子查詢作為表71
3.10.2子查詢作為集合71
3.10.3子查詢作為標量74
3.10.4關系除76
3.11遞歸查詢77
3.12數據修改78
3.12.1數據插入78
3.12.2數據刪除79
3.12.3數據更新80
習題81
第4章MySQL應用/83
4.1應用體系結構83
4.1.1C/S結構83
4.1.2B/S結構84
4.2Python訪問MySQL86
4.3JDBC編程87
4.3.1JDBC基礎87
4.3.2JDBC程序88
4.3.3預備語句89
4.3.4元數據90
4.3.5Java應用連接訪問數據庫實例91
4.3.6Java小應用連接訪問數據庫實例91
4.3.7JSP連接訪問數據庫實例93
4.3.8Servlet連接訪問數據庫實例95
4.4ODBC編程101
4.5存儲函數和過程102
4.5.1變量的定義和賦值103
4.5.2控制結構103
4.5.3存儲函數定義和執行104
4.5.4存儲過程定義和執行105
習題106
第5章MySQL數據保護/108
5.1數據保護108
5.2視圖109
5.2.1視圖的創建和撤銷109
5.2.2對視圖的操作111
5.3訪問控制112
5.3.1用戶與角色管理113
5.3.2授予權限114
5.3.3收回權限116
5.4完整性約束116
5.4.1約束含義116
5.4.2聲明及檢驗117
5.5觸發器122
5.5.1定義觸發器122
5.5.2激活觸發器124
5.5.3刪除觸發器124
5.6事務125
5.7加密126
習題128
第 三 部 分
第6章數據庫設計: 實體聯系方法/131
6.1數據庫設計方法和生命周期131
6.2基本ER模型133
6.2.1ER模型基本元素133
6.2.2基本ER圖設計134
6.3基本ER圖轉換為關系模式141
6.4擴展ER圖及到關系模式的轉換143
6.4.1弱實體143
6.4.2父子實體144
6.5大數據ER圖及其到關系模式的轉換149
習題151
第7章數據庫設計: 屬性聯系方法/153
7.1數據依賴153
7.1.1函數依賴的定義153
7.1.2函數依賴的邏輯蘊涵154
7.1.3函數依賴的推理規則155
7.1.4屬性集的閉包156
7.1.5函數依賴集的*小依賴集158
7.1.6多值依賴158
7.2模式分解159
7.2.1無損聯接分解159
7.2.2分解無損聯接檢驗161
7.2.3保持函數依賴的分解165
7.3范式168
7.3.1第1范式169
7.3.2第2范式169
7.3.3第3范式170
7.3.4BC范式171
7.3.5第4范式172
7.4規范化173
7.5大數據與反規范化175
習題177
第 四 部 分
第8章存儲和存取/181
8.1存儲器件181
8.2磁盤181
8.3DBMS文件管理183
8.4數據庫文件組織183
8.4.1行存儲183
8.4.2列存儲186
8.5文件中元組組織187
8.6索引190
8.6.1稠密索引和稀疏索引191
8.6.2多級索引192
8.6.3B+樹索引193
8.6.4哈希方法195
8.7數據字典的存儲197
習題197
第9章查詢處理與優化/198
9.1查詢處理過程及查詢優化問題198
9.2關系代數表達式的等價變換與優化200
9.2.1關系代數表達式等價變換規則200
9.2.2關系代數等價變換的啟發式規則203
9.3實現關系運算的算法與優化203
9.3.1選擇運算的算法與優化203
9.3.2聯接運算的算法與優化204
9.4表達式的求值方法與優化207
9.4.1實體化207
9.4.2流水線207
9.5基于代價的定量優化208
習題208
第10章事務處理/210
10.1事務的概念210
10.1.1如果沒有事務210
10.1.2事務及其特性211
10.2并發執行和調度214
10.2.1并發執行214
10.2.2可串行化216
10.3并發控制218
10.3.1鎖218
10.3.2兩階段封鎖219
10.3.3死鎖220
10.3.4并發控制221
10.4故障恢復222
10.4.1恢復準備222
10.4.2恢復處理224
10.5小結227
習題227
第 五 部 分
第11章大數據技術/231
11.1大數據特征231
11.2大數據關鍵技術231
11.3分布式文件系統232
11.3.1計算機集群232
11.3.2分布式文件系統232
11.4NoSQL數據模型233
11.4.1鍵/值存儲234
11.4.2列族存儲235
11.4.3文檔存儲235
11.4.4圖存儲236
11.5大數據計算236
11.5.1批處理237
11.5.2流式計算239
11.6大數據應用240
11.6.1基于內容推薦240
11.6.2協同過濾推薦241
11.7小結242
習題243
附錄A實驗指導/244
實驗1Access數據庫244
實驗2MySQL基礎和安裝244
實驗3數據庫的基本操作245
實驗4數據表的基本操作246
實驗5數據備份與還原248
實驗6簡單數據查詢250
實驗7高級數據查詢252
實驗8Java連接數據庫255
實驗9存儲過程和函數257
實驗10索引和視圖257
實驗11MySQL權限管理258
實驗12觸發器259
實驗13性能優化260
實驗14事務與并發控制260
實驗15PowerDesigner261
實驗16綜合應用262
實驗評分標準262
實驗報告要求263
實驗報告模板263
實驗軟件下載264
附錄B案例: 網絡考試系統/265
B.1需求分析266
B.2系統總體設計268
B.2.1系統框架268
B.2.2系統設計原則268
B.2.3系統功能要求269
B.2.4開發架構選擇270
B.2.5關鍵技術270
B.2.6頁面流程圖273
B.3數據庫設計275
B.3.1概念結構設計275
B.3.2邏輯結構設計275
B.3.3數據庫表的設計275
B.4系統實現281
B.4.1實現模式281
B.4.2模塊展示282
B.5小結284
參考文獻/286
數據庫應用、設計與實現 第2版 作者簡介
2003年6月于華中科技大學計算機學院獲工學博士學位;2005年6月于清華大學計算機系博士后流動站出站,獲博士后證書;2005年7月入北京師范大學信息學院工作;2006年7月晉升副教授;2007年8月任系主任;2010年入選“教育部新世紀優秀人才支持計劃”;2012年7月晉升教授。 目前擔任清華大學校友會IT分會副秘書長,中國計算機學會數據庫專業委員會委員、中國計算機學會服務計算專業委員會委員、中國計算機學會YOCSEF委員、國家自然科學基金評審專家、北京市自然科學基金評審專家、北京市海淀區科學技術委員會科技項目評審專家、北京師范大學繼續教育與教師培訓學院網絡教學指導委員會委員、中國計算機學會高級會員。 當前主要科研項目包括:教育部新世紀優秀人才支持計劃(NCET-10-0239,數據廣播中的移動實時事務恢復處理)、國家自然科學基金(61370064,基于替換的實時Web服務事務處理)、國家自然科學基金(61073034,無線移動實時數據廣播中的高性能并發控制)、國家自然科學基金(60940032,實時數據廣播中的并發控制)、國家科技支撐計劃重大項目子課題(XXX應急平臺數據庫系統)、國家科技支撐計劃重點項目
- >
經典常談
- >
大紅狗在馬戲團-大紅狗克里弗-助人
- >
我與地壇
- >
詩經-先民的歌唱
- >
二體千字文
- >
名家帶你讀魯迅:朝花夕拾
- >
人文閱讀與收藏·良友文學叢書:一天的工作
- >
推拿